Lost Grub boot loader | How to reinstall?
Hi All,
I had a dual boot system to boot Vista and Suse 10.3. Its was working fine but today I had to do system recovery for Vista due to some annoying thing in windows. The recovery [I hate it now] probably deleted Grub boot loader from MBR. So as a result my system does not have a dual boot anymore. It always boots Windows Vista now. This is what I have tried so far to resolve this issue:
Boot system from Suse 10.3 DVD and
1. Try Repair Installed system. Result:It gives an error and finally Prompts with a menu where I can select Installation and system update and other things, which also did not help.
2. Rescue System. Result: Does not help, same as above.
I have almost everything in my suse partition and most importantly I don't want to loose my 10.3.
I was thinking if I could reinstall Grub and things could start working again. If that's the right path then how can i reinstall it?

Re: Lost Grub boot loader | How to reinstall?
Resolved!!
Here is how:
1. Boot the system from DVD.
2. Choose Repair Installed System
3. System Installation and Update
4. Choose Boot system -> this will give you $ prompt
5. login as root
6. Enter this command: grub-install --recheck <root partition>
7. In most <root partition> is /dev/hda
